But Why Do Most Verification Companies Ask for Social Security Numbers Anyway?

Other companies require the use of Social Security numbers for two reasons:

  1. To identify that the employee who creates an account on their site is who they say they are. This ensures that when the employee goes to approve the release of requests, it's truly them who is approving it.
  2. To enable verifiers to search for someone's information. To do this, they typically enter the company name (or company code/company ID) and the Social Security number.

Do I Really Need to Worry About a Breach of Social Security Numbers?

According to NPR, the threat of hackers stealing Social Security numbers is not only real, but incredibly high. NPR notes that, "Jay Jacobs, lead data scientist at Verizon for the breach report, is a foremost expert who has been slicing and dicing this data for years. He estimates 60-80% of social security numbers have been stolen by hackers."

Jacobs goes on to say that since companies are storing Social Security numbers online, hacking attempts are at an all-time high. He states, "Now that everything is digital, if hackers compromise a server or data warehouse, that theft scales into the millions, quickly. It's gotten somewhat easy for the attacker. I think we're underestimating just how [many] records are out there."

In addition, VerificationManager uses Veratad, a world-class provider of online/real-time Identity Verification and Knowledge Based Authentication Solutions to verify the identity of ex-employees or active employees without a company email.

Here's how the process works:

  • For ex-employees: The employee enters minimal information about themselves. (E.g. last name and birthdate.) After the info has been entered, Veratad searches public records and presents them with a series of questions they must answer correctly in order to create an account.
  • For current employees: VerificationManager simply sends a confirmation email to their work email address.
